#dc4815 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dc4815 is composed of 86.3% red, 28.2% green and 8.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 67.3% magenta, 90.5%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 15.4 degrees, a saturation of 82.6% and a lightness of 47.3%. #dc4815 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ff902a with #b90000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

Shades and Tints of #dc4815

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050200 is the darkest color, while #fef5f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#dc4815

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f7572 is the less saturated color, while #ef3f02 is the most saturated one.
